Daurice Fountain (born December 22, 1995) is an American football wide receiver for the Kansas City Chiefs of the National Football League (NFL). He played college football at Northern Iowa.[1]
College career[]
In 2017, Fountain had 943 receiving yards and 12 touchdowns. He was invited to the East-West Shrine Game and was named offensive MVP. Nevertheless, he was not invited to the NFL scouting combine.
Professional career[]
Indianapolis Colts[]
Fountain was drafted by the Indianapolis Colts in the fifth round, 159th overall, of the 2018 NFL Draft.[2] He was waived on September 1, 2018 and was signed to the practice squad the next day.[3][4] On December 7, Fountain was promoted to the active roster.[5]
On August 19, 2019, Fountain was placed on injured reserve after undergoing ankle surgery.[6]
Fountain signed a one-year exclusive-rights free agent tender with the team on March 31, 2020.[7] He was waived on September 5, 2020 and signed to the practice squad the next day.[8][9] He was promoted to the active roster on September 16, 2020.[10] He recorded his first career reception in the Colts week 3 game against the New York Jets. The reception would be a 12-yard reception. He was waived on October 31, 2020,[11] and re-signed to the practice squad three days later.[12] He was elevated to the active roster on November 7 for the team's week 9 game against the Baltimore Ravens, and reverted to the practice squad after the game.[13] His practice squad contract with the team expired after the season on January 18, 2021.[14]
Kansas City Chiefs[]
Fountain signed with the Kansas City Chiefs on May 17, 2021.[15] He was released on October 12, 2021.[16] He signed to the practice squad on October 14, 2021.[17]
